Why Rising Fees and Insurance Costs Are Hitting Everyone’s Wallets Hard

July 5, 2026
in Economy, General
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

As economic pressures mount across households nationwide, many citizens are voicing growing concerns about the true cost of living in today’s economy. Among the most contentious issues are escalating fees and insurance expenses, factors that often go overlooked in traditional economic indicators but have a profound impact on everyday budgets. This article delves into why people increasingly say the economy is bad, focusing on the burden of hidden fees and rising insurance costs, and explores the broader implications for consumers and policy makers alike.

Rising Fees Strain Household Budgets and Deepen Economic Anxiety

Household budgets across the nation are increasingly stretched thin as fees in everyday essentials-from banking to utilities-keep climbing at rates far above wage growth. Families are forced to allocate greater portions of their income just to maintain basic services, with hidden and often unexpected charges exacerbating the pressure. Many Americans report feeling trapped in a cycle of mounting expenses, where the cost of living rises with little relief, creating an anxious atmosphere that undermines financial security and long-term planning.

Insurance premiums have become a particularly heavy burden. Auto, health, and home insurance rates have surged, leaving policymakers and consumers alike questioning the sustainability of these increases. This financial strain disproportionately affects vulnerable groups, including the elderly and low-income families, who often face the tough choice between essential coverage and other vital expenses. The cumulative effect of these rising fees and premiums is fueling widespread economic anxiety, contributing to the narrative that the economy is not just sluggish but actively worsening for many.

  • Bank fees increased by 12% in the last year
  • Utilities fees averaging a 9% rise
  • Health insurance premiums up 15% nationwide
  • Auto insurance claims driving a 10% hike in costs
Fee Type Average Increase (Year-over-Year) Impact Level
Banking Services 12% High
Utilities 9% Moderate
Health Insurance 15% Severe
Auto Insurance 10% High

The Hidden Costs of Insurance Undermine Financial Stability for Millions

Across the nation, insurance premiums and associated fees quietly chip away at household budgets, creating invisible barriers to economic security. While many are aware of insurance as a necessary safeguard, the cumulative effect of hidden charges-ranging from administrative fees to non-transparent policy adjustments-escalates the total financial burden. For millions, these costs can mean the difference between stability and persistent financial strain, particularly among low- and middle-income families who allocate a higher percentage of their earnings to coverage.

Consider how these incremental expenses accumulate over time:

  • Monthly premium hikes that outpace inflation
  • Service fees that are buried within billing statements
  • Penalties for payment delays or policy changes
  • Mandatory add-ons pushed by insurers to increase coverage costs

Below is a snapshot illustrating typical hidden charges embedded in common insurance policies:

Type of Fee Estimated Annual Cost Percentage of Total Premium
Administrative Fees $120 10%
Processing & Service Charges $75 7%
Policy Adjustment Penalties $50 4%
Mandatory Riders & Add-ons $130 11%

Policy Reforms Needed to Curb Fees and Make Insurance More Accessible

To address the steep costs burdening everyday citizens, policymakers must implement targeted reforms that directly challenge the opaque fee structures prevalent in many sectors. Mandatory transparency measures, for instance, can compel companies to disclose all hidden charges upfront, allowing consumers to make informed decisions without surprise costs. Furthermore, introducing fee caps on essential services-particularly in banking, telecommunications, and healthcare-can prevent exploitative pricing practices that disproportionately affect low- and middle-income families.

Insurance accessibility also demands urgent reform. Expanding eligibility criteria and promoting community-based risk pooling models can lower premiums and offer broader coverage. A comparative overview highlights the stark differences between current policies and proposed reforms:

Aspect Current System Proposed Reform
Fee Transparency Limited disclosure Full upfront disclosure
Fee Limits No caps Regulated maximum fees
Insurance Eligibility Restrictive, income-based Expanded, inclusive
Risk Pools Individualized Community-based

To Conclude

As the debate over the state of the economy continues, it becomes clear that the burdens of hidden fees and rising insurance costs play a significant role in shaping public perception. While official economic indicators may paint a more optimistic picture, the everyday financial pressures faced by many Americans tell a different story. Understanding these underlying factors is essential for a more comprehensive discussion about economic well-being and policy solutions moving forward.
